1. YouTube’s Evolution: From Cat Videos to $300B Empire

YouTube has transformed from a simple video-sharing platform (founded 2005) into the world’s second-largest search engine and de facto video OS, with:

  • 2.7 billion monthly active users (35% of internet users)
  • 1 billion hours watched daily (Netflix’s entire quarterly viewing in 1 day)
  • $29.2 billion annual ad revenue (Google’s second-largest income stream)

2.2 Video Processing Pipeline

  1. Ingestion: 500+ hours uploaded/minute
  2. Transcoding: 8 resolution/format versions per video
  3. Content Analysis:
    • Visual (CNN for objects/scenes)
    • Audio (NLP for speech/text)
    • Metadata (Title/tags semantic analysis)

4. YouTube’s Technical Infrastructure

4.1 Storage & Delivery

  • Total Storage: ~2.5 exabytes (2.5B GB)
  • Edge Caching: 200+ Points of Presence
  • Video Codecs:
    • AV1 (30% bandwidth savings)
    • VP9 (Legacy 4K)
    • H.264 (Compatibility)
